The Power Players: Top Website Accessibility Testers and Validators

Now, let’s talk about these tools.

They’re like having a team of accessibility experts on speed dial.

Here’s the lowdown on some top picks:

  • WAVE: The granddaddy of accessibility testing
  • axe: The developer’s Swiss Army knife
  • Lighthouse: Google’s gift to accessibility testing
  • AChecker: The detail-oriented validator

Each has its own superpowers. The trick? Finding the one that vibes with your style.

The Catch: What These Tools Can’t Do

Now, don’t get me wrong. These tools are awesome.

But they’re not magic wands.

Here’s the deal:

  • They can’t catch everything – some issues need the human touch
  • They might give false positives – like that overzealous smoke alarm in your kitchen
  • They can’t understand context – that’s where your brain comes in

The key? Use them as a starting point, not the finish line.
